What is the volume of the given prism? round the answer to the nearest tenth of a centimeter. 9.4 cm 5.4 cm 11.7 cm?

The volume of a cuboid is the product of its dimensions.
  (9.4 cm)·(5.4 cm)·(11.7 cm) = 593.892 cm³ ≈ 593.9 cm³
